Line is shrinking on Line Chart when many values are included
rcheskin The problem is with the large data points, when you select multiple values from the slicer like brand 1 and brand 2, you will see an icon like i on the visual, and that explains it is showing sample data points and in that case, the starting point for reference line is getting removed. You can check that by clicking the show as a table as shown in the image below, and you will see in the table when multiple brands are selected the data point for 20hz for the reference line disappears.
